Hello,

Kenwood XD-701 (mini system) is after accidental contact of the
speaker wires still going into protection mode. After startup-sequence
main relay turns off and display starts flashing "protection".
There is a amp board with some STK IC, 3 relays, few transistors...
What should I check? How can I check if the protection is OK or how
can I bypass it to check the power IC?
When I disconnect amp board from main (biggest) board, hifi operates
OK but of course without sound. Does the cable connecting amp and main
board contain only sound signals or protection signal too? Can
somebody send me service manual?

Thank you very much,
Rado.

Chances are the STK IC on the channel you shorted is blown and will need
replacing, that's about the only thing that ever goes.

unsolder stk (audio output) unit should power up without reading protect- with
this info it should tell you to replace stk IC
